The City Council of the City of Danville DOES ORDAIN as
follows:
SECTION 1. Chapter 7, consisting of sections 12-701 thorugh
12-706 is added to Title 12 of the Danville Municipal Code to
read as follows:
"Chapter 7
Truck Routes
Section 12-701 Definitions
Section 12-702 Prohibition of Use of City Streets
Section 12-703 Through Truck Route Established
Section 12-704 Weigh-In
Section 12-705 Exceptions
Section 12-706 Penalty
Section 12-701. Definitions.
In this chapter unless the context otherwise requires:
1. "restricted street" means all streets in the City
except through truck routes established in this
chapter;
2. "through truck route" means a street upon which the
unrestricted use of trucks is permitted;
3. "truck" means a vehicle exceeding a maximum gross
weight of 14,000 pounds.
Section 12-702. Prohibition of Use of the City Streets.
No person may drive or park or permit a vehicle exceeding a
gross maximum weight of 14,000 pounds to be driven or parked on a
restricted street within the City.
Section 12-703. Throuqh Truck Route Established.
a. The following streets are declared to be through truck
routes for the movement of trucks:

Street From To
Sycamore Valley Road Interstate Hwy 680 Camino Tassajara
Camino Tassajara Sycamore Valley Rd. Blackhawk Road
b. The City Council determines under the authority of
Vehicle Code section 35701(b) that the posting of an
appropriate sign as "through truck route" is the method
of designation which will best serve to give notice of
this chapter. This chapter is effective when
appropriate signs are erected as indicated.
Section 12-704. Weigh-In.
A police officer may require a person driving or in control
of a truck not proceeding over a through truck route to proceed
to a public or private scale available for the purpose of
weighing and determining whether this section has been complied
with.
Section 12-705. Exceptions.
This chapter does not apply to the following:
1. A truck coming from an unrestricted street having
ingress and egress by direct route to and from a
restricted street when necessary to make a pickup or
delivery of goods, wares and merchandise from or to a
building or structure located on a restricted street or
for the purpose of delivering material to be used in
the actual and bona fide repair, alteration, remodeling
or construction of a building or structure upon a
restricted street for which a building permit has
previously been issued;
2. School bus and passenger bus under the jurisdiction of
the Public Utilities Commission;
3. A vehicle owned or operated by a public utility or a
licensed contractor while necessarily in use in the
construction, installation or repair of a public
utility;
4. A vehicle owned or operated by the city or a vehicle
used for the removal of refuse under contract with the
City;
5. An authorized emergency vehicle.

Section 12-706. Penalty.
A person who violates this ordinance is punishable by a fine
of not more than $500, imprisonment for not more than six months,
or both. Each violation and each day during any portion of which
this ordinance is violated is a separate offense."
SECTION 2. Publication.
The City Clerk shall either a) have this ordinance published
once within 15 days after adoption in a newspaper of general
circulation or b) have a summary of this ordinance published
twice in a newspaper of general circulation, once five days
before its adoption and again within 15 days after adoption.
